A more effective option is a balanced ventilation system through which incoming air is offset by an equal quantity of outgoing air, which retains air stress within the constructing near neutral. Builders and designers who specialize in superinsulated houses with very low air leakage rates now are possible to include either a heat- or energy-restoration ventilator within the plans. These mechanical programs are similar in that they have a core by way of which each incoming and outgoing air journey to transfer energy and, in the case of ERVs, moisture. In a heat-recovery ventilator, or HRV, there’s an change of thermal vitality across the core. That is what engineers name "sensible heat." In winter, exhaust air transfers some of its thermal energy to incoming fresh air, reducing a lot of the power loss that would otherwise take place.
